IManagedAddin::Load
載入 Managed VSTO 增益集時呼叫。
語法
HRESULT Load([in] BSTR bstrManifestURL,
[in] IDispatch *pdispApplication);
參數
參數 | 描述 |
---|---|
bstrManifestURL | VSTO 增益集之資訊清單的完整路徑。 |
pdispApplication | IDispatch 的指標,表示載入 VSTO 載入宏的主應用程式。 |
傳回值
HRESULT 值,表示此方法是否已順利完成。
備註
資訊清單是一種檔案 (通常是 XML 檔案),可提供協助載入 VSTO 增益集的資訊。 例如,資訊清單可以指定 VSTO 增益集組件的位置,以及載入 VSTO 增益集時要具現化的進入點類別。
bstrManifestURL 參數包含 VSTO 載入宏之 HKEY_CURRENT_USER\Software\Microsoft\Office\<application name>\Addins\addins\<add-in ID> 登錄機碼下的專案值。Manifest
如需詳細資訊,請參閱 IManagedAddin 介面。
實作 IManagedAddIn::Load 方法可針對所要載入之 VSTO 增益集執行工作,例如設定增益集的應用程式定義域和安全性原則。